Amber Ruffin is getting a linear bow for her Peacock late-night show.
The Amber Ruffin Show will air in a 1:30 a.m. slot on NBC on Friday February 26 and March 5. It will take the slot of repeats of A Little Late with Lilly Singh, which do not generally air on Friday nights.
The move is a boon for the nascent late-night show, giving it a chance to find new viewers on the linear network.
